After jumping and bashing the Mojave, the rear hinge pin blocks started falling apart, so I replaced them with the M2C hinge pin block system. Also the top carbon fiber plate in the front fell apart, so I replaced it with a JUST BASH IT one. I did have to drill the hole where the chassis brace goes so that I could fit a 2.5mm bolt. No biggie. Ready to go!

Wow, so much for the CF Top plate. :(
Just not a fan of CF for bashing. For this reason. I used CF years back and they all broke the same way. Pan car chassis, Towers on my 10T and GT etc.
CF best for Speed Runners . Just for the weight savings alone. Not for durability.

Unfortunately it didn't stand a chance. Maybe if you don't jump it might work out fine, but yeah, for hardcore bashing I wouldn't trust CF. That plate takes a lot of abuse from the chassis brace too, so it has to be very solid. The vehicle came with that plated when I bought it. Now CF tubing around a chassis brace is where it works great as reinforcement 👍
 
^^^ Absolutely.
I use CF tubing sleeved onto every single one of my OE T2T braces. They never bend now. Before they always did. Even with a simple love tap.
I wrecked my Lim going 80+ Mph. Was a twisted mess. Needed a whole new Lim roller because I needed most of the parts. Chassis and all destroyed . The stocker T2T was still perfectly straight with CF over it.

Well the motor didn't like them too much. Like a damn rookie, I tried to do a speed run on grass for like 5 minutes and I think that the motor got too hot. It's hard to turn 🤦. And I have a temperature gun and I didn't bother to use the sensor wire so that the ESC could help me save the motor from disaster. Totally my fault. It worked OK at night on pavement, but not on grass during the day.
